Itinerary Details
Travelers can look forward to a well-structured itinerary that maximizes their time exploring the majestic Taj Mahal and the historic Agra Fort.
The day begins with convenient pickup from various locations like Delhi, Gurugram, or Noida.
First, they’ll enjoy a guided tour of the Taj Mahal for about 2.5 hours, soaking in its beauty and rich history.
Next, they’ll head to Agra Fort for a one-hour guided exploration.
A delicious lunch at a local restaurant follows, lasting 45 minutes.
For those interested, an optional visit to the Tomb of Itmad-Ud-Daulah, also known as the Baby Taj, offers an additional 30 minutes of guided insight.

Important Information
When embarking on the Private Taj Mahal & Agra Fort Day Trip, guests should remember to bring a passport or ID card, comfortable shoes, and sunglasses for a smooth experience. Preparation makes all the difference in enjoying this iconic journey.
Here are a few important points to keep in mind:
-
Shorts aren’t allowed at the Taj Mahal, so dress appropriately.
-
The monument is closed every Friday, so plan accordingly.
-
Various languages are available for tours, including English, Spanish, and German.
The trip is also wheelchair accessible, making it suitable for everyone.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is the Best Time of Year to Visit the Taj Mahal?
The best time to visit the Taj Mahal is from October to March. During these months, the weather’s pleasant, allowing visitors to fully enjoy the stunning architecture and serene atmosphere without the scorching heat of summer.

Is Photography Allowed Inside the Taj Mahal?
Photography isn’t allowed inside the Taj Mahal’s main mausoleum. However, visitors can capture stunning images of the exterior and surrounding gardens. It’s wise to respect the rules to preserve this iconic site for everyone.
